The most awaited 65th Frankfurt motor show is about to held next week. To showcase its world premiere in this motor show, Lexus will introduce its mid-sized Crossover concept, the LF-NX. According to the carmaker, "the LF-NX concept is powered by a new variant of the Lexus Hybrid Drive system tuned for SUV performance."

Lexus LF-NX hybrid concept 

In the LF-NX concept, Lexus continuing its L-finesse design concept with some additional development in the exterior design. The front side is covered with a strong interpretation of the Lexus spindle grille, extremely expressive signature front lighting with autoprophic Daytime Running Lights (DRL). The sharp vertical cut line is placed on the front corners that separates the bumper from the front wings that gives an aggressive look to the Lexus LF-NX.

The Lexus LF-NX concept is designed with the new Brushed Metal Silver colour which makes the vehicle’s look like it has been sculpted from a single piece of solid metal.

 

Lexus has released only one image of the cabin which clearly describes that the cabin is highly ergonomic and driver-oriented. Furnishings of the Lexus LF-NX is made from a Sunrise Yellow and Black leather contrast stitching. Dashboard is also decorated with blue instrument lighting which creates cool ambiance in the cabin.

The interior of Lexus LF-NX is filled with Futuristic yet realistic technology that includes touch-sensitive electrostatic switches and a touchpad Remote Touch Interface (RTI) design.

 

The Lexus has scheduled a press conference on 10th September, at the Lexus stand in Hall 8. The automaker has not released powertrain details. However. it is assumed to be revealed in this press conference.
